🔧 Maintenance
Service Intervals
Engine Oil Change:
Typically every 250 or 500 hours, depending on operating conditions and oil type. Refer to manual for exact intervals.
Fuel Filter Replacement:
Recommended at first oil change and then every 500 hours, or as per manual for specific applications.
Hydraulic Oil Change:
Typically every 1000 hours, or as dictated by fluid analysis.
Fluid Specifications
Engine Oil Grade:
API CJ-4 or ACEA E9 (or later specifications), viscosity typically 15W-40 or 10W-40 depending on ambient temperature. Consult manual for exact API/ACEA and viscosity recommendations.
Hydraulic Fluid Type:
New Holland HLP-46 hydraulic oil or equivalent ISO VG 46 hydraulic fluid. Check manual for specific recommendations and alternative fluids.
Transmission Oil Type:
New Holland TDH (Tractor Transmission/Hydraulic Fluid) or equivalent UTTO (Universal Tractor Transmission Oil) lubricant. Consult manual for specific grade and capacity.
Known Issues
Common Wear Items:
Clutch components (especially in shuttle models with heavy use), hydraulic pump and valve wear, PTO clutch packs, front axle pivot wear.
Electrical Concerns:
Wiring harness integrity in harsh environments, sensor reliability (e.g., speed sensors, temperature sensors).
Engine Performance:
Potential for injector issues or turbocharger problems under heavy load or poor maintenance. EGR valve or DPF issues if applicable to specific emission standards.
